Default exhaust valve adj. help

Can someone tell me how to adjust the exhaust expansion valve on my 88 Lt 250 R ? thanks

With the cover on the dial side off assemble and install the exhaust valve then put the cover on and leave the screws loose then turn the dial 360 degrees counter clockwise and tighten screws down dont forget to reconnect linkage on other side if cylinder has been off...

the exhaust valve gives you a much better power band the faster you rev the the engine. Is what creates exhuast gas preasure which turns the valve so you get a much better top end performance, While still giving you great low end power so if it is not working properly you would only notice it on the top end if you think the spring is stretched just replace it.
